The video discusses economic challenges in Jackson, Mississippi, focusing on the impact of stimulus checks ending, poverty, and legislative changes. It highlights the need for higher wages and equal pay, especially for women. The video also addresses the concerns of young residents who are leaving the state for better opportunities. The discussion includes the potential removal of personal income tax and its implications, as well as the importance of improving education and infrastructure.
